Cookies

You can control whether or not to accept cookies. A 'cookie' is a small text file that a web server may place on your computer when you visit a web site. The file uniquely identifies a browser/computer and information stored in a cookie sent by a NYCB web page can only be read by NYCB (or a company we work with). You can modify your browser setting to either notify you when you receive a cookie so you can choose whether or not to accept it or set your browser to not accept cookies automatically. If you decide to not accept cookies, some features and services on the Site may not work properly because we may not be able to recognize and associate you with your account(s).


Web Site Tracking

We try and place advertisements where we think they will be most relevant to our customers. Third party companies we work with may place and track our advertisements on third-party websites. As there is no technical standard for how Do Not Track consumer browser settings should work on commercial websites, the marketing industry has undertaken certain self-regulatory initiatives to provide consumers with a choice of the types of ads they may see online and to enable them to opt-out from online behavioral ads served by some or all of the companies participating in these programs reasonably conveniently. Because of the absence of such technical standards, we cannot ensure that the Site will respond to Do Not Track consumer browser settings in any particular instance.


If you prefer to not receive targeted advertising, you can opt out of some network advertising programs that use your information by visiting the Network Advertising Alliance ("NAI") site at networkadvertising.org/choices/. This will not avoid you from seeing any ads, but will avoid having any relate to your interests as determined during your web browsing. The NAI web site also offers a tool that identifies its member companies that have placed cookies on your browser and provides links to those companies. Please note that network advertising companies that provide these services have their own privacy policies and are not subject to our Online Privacy Statement.
